Suspects in ambush killing at Detroit gas station arrested, police say mom was holding baby when shot
DETROIT -- The Detroit Police Departments says it has arrested a pair of suspects in connection with a fatal shooting at a gas station Monday night. Marshae Nash, 21, and her boyfriend, Benson Lindsey, 22, were shot and killed Monday night while sitting in their car at the Marathon gas station near Ashton and West Warren. At a press conference Tuesday, Detroit Police Chief James White said the victims and suspects were not strangers. Police said there is still work to be done in the case, despite the arrest of the suspects.
